D:/ Application Not Found
Hi, 1st poster here! :D
I have a problem and its driving me INSAAAANNNEEEEE I want to reformat my hdd and to do this I need to use my Vista cd. My DVD drive isn't working. When i insert the Vista CD nothing happens, no autorun. When i right click and go to explore it ejects the disk and sais please enter a disk. When I double click the drive icon it says D:/Application Not Found. When i change boot settings to boot from DVD drive nothing happens it tries to read it for a while then skips past and loads via HDD. If i put a game cd in the same thing happens, yet, when i load the game via desktop shortcut the game loads and plays fine so the DVD drive is obviously still reading the disk (the game cannot play without the CD) This appears to be a common problem as ive scoured forums throughout google but i have found no solutions. So, I am looking for help to fix the problem or reformat via a USB Drive. My motherboard allows to boot via USB so getting a Vista recovery disk onto USB could be an option.
